WordPress Staging Environment: How to Set Up Safe Testing Sites

A WordPress staging environment is a safe copy of your live site where you can test updates, plugin changes, design edits, and performance adjustments before they go public. For site owners focused on hosting and performance, it is one of the most practical ways to reduce risk while working on speed, stability, and compatibility.

Staging is especially useful for websites that rely on WordPress hosting, WooCommerce hosting, or resource-sensitive shared, VPS, cloud, or managed hosting plans. It helps you check whether a change affects server response time, caching behaviour, Core Web Vitals, or checkout flows without disrupting visitors.

What a WordPress staging environment does

A staging site is a clone of your live WordPress installation, usually hosted on a separate subdomain or protected area. It should mirror the production site closely enough to test themes, plugins, PHP updates, database changes, caching settings, and new content layouts in realistic conditions.

This matters because performance problems are rarely caused by hosting alone. A slow page may be linked to large images, unoptimised scripts, database queries, too many plugins, poor theme code, or external services. Staging lets you isolate changes and compare behaviour before and after each update.

Why safe testing protects speed, uptime, and business continuity

Testing directly on a live website can lead to broken layouts, login issues, cart errors, or temporary downtime. That is a serious concern for blogs, lead generation sites, and ecommerce stores that depend on reliable performance and steady conversions.

With a staging site, you can test maintenance tasks during lower-risk periods, then deploy only once you are confident. This is useful when reviewing hosting migration steps, changing PHP versions, enabling a cache plugin, adjusting CDN settings, or checking whether a new extension affects database load. How to set up a staging site safely

The exact method depends on your hosting provider, but the basic process is similar. Many managed WordPress hosting plans include one-click staging, while shared hosting may require manual setup through a subdomain or separate directory. VPS, cloud, and dedicated hosting can offer more control, but they also require more technical responsibility.

Practical setup steps

Start with a full backup of files and the database. Keep an independent copy off-site rather than relying only on the hosting account. Then create the staging copy, confirm that it is blocked from indexing, and ensure that it is password-protected or otherwise restricted so search engines and visitors do not treat it as a public site.

Once the staging site is ready, check key elements: homepage load time, logged-in behaviour, forms, search, payment flow, plugin compatibility, image handling, and whether caching rules behave as expected. If you use WordPress hosting or WooCommerce hosting, verify that cart, checkout, and account pages are excluded from full-page caching where needed.

Hosting choices and performance trade-offs

Different hosting types affect how useful staging will be and how much testing headroom you have. Shared hosting is usually the most affordable, but resources such as CPU, memory, and disk throughput are shared with other accounts, so heavy testing can be constrained. VPS hosting gives more isolated resources and more control, which can suit developers or growing sites that need predictable performance. Cloud hosting can scale more flexibly, although configuration varies widely by provider.

Managed hosting reduces day-to-day administration and often includes WordPress-specific tools such as staging, backups, and updates. Dedicated hosting offers the most isolated resources, but it also requires the most technical oversight. None of these options is automatically best for everyone; the right choice depends on traffic, budget, technical skill, security needs, and how often you change the site.

As your site grows, you may outgrow your current plan because of higher traffic, a larger database, more concurrent users, or heavier plugin and media usage. Staging can help you test whether a move to a stronger plan or a hosting migration is justified before you commit.

What to test before pushing changes live

A staging environment is most useful when you test changes one at a time and note the effect of each adjustment. This makes it easier to spot whether a cache tweak improved server response time, whether a new plugin slowed the backend, or whether a theme update increased layout shifts.

Pay attention to Core Web Vitals, but read them correctly. Largest Contentful Paint measures when the main visible content appears, Interaction to Next Paint reflects responsiveness to user input, and Cumulative Layout Shift measures unexpected movement on the page. These metrics matter for user experience, but they are not the only indicators of quality, and laboratory scores do not always match real-user field data.

Performance tools such as PageSpeed Insights can help you spot bottlenecks, but results will vary by device, location, network speed, cache state, and testing method. A fast lab score does not guarantee that every visitor will have the same experience, especially if third-party scripts, slow database queries, or distant server locations are involved.

Common mistakes to avoid in staging and testing

One common error is letting staging become an exact public copy without protection. That can create duplicate content, indexing confusion, or security concerns. Another mistake is enabling multiple performance plugins that overlap, such as several caching or image-optimisation tools, which can conflict and cause broken assets or inconsistent results.

It is also risky to assume that CDN use will solve every speed issue. A content delivery network can reduce the distance for static files such as images, CSS, and JavaScript, but it does not fix slow database queries, inefficient code, or an overloaded origin server. Likewise, incorrect caching rules can create outdated pages, login problems, or cart errors.

Troubleshooting after deployment

After moving changes from staging to live, verify DNS settings, clear and warm relevant caches, and test critical pages again. Check key templates on desktop and mobile, because performance can differ by device and browser. Also confirm that backups still run correctly and that restore tests have been performed recently enough to trust them.

Uptime monitoring can alert you when a problem happens, but it cannot prevent every outage. Pair monitoring with sensible backups, secure file permissions, SSL/TLS, malware protection, and regular updates. For ecommerce sites, keep a close eye on checkout and account areas after deployment because they often rely on dynamic functionality that caching must not interfere with.

Frequently Asked Questions

What is the difference between staging and a backup?

A backup is a restorable copy of your site, while staging is a working test environment. A backup protects you if something goes wrong; staging lets you safely try changes before they affect visitors.

Should I use staging on shared hosting?

Yes, if your host supports it or you can create a protected subdomain. Just be aware that shared hosting may have tighter limits on resources, so testing should be efficient and not overload the account.

Can staging help with WooCommerce performance testing?

Yes. It is a sensible place to test product pages, cart behaviour, checkout flows, caching exclusions, and plugin updates without risking live orders. You should still validate the live site after deployment.

Does a staging site need to match production exactly?

It should match closely enough to produce useful results, but some differences are normal. The key is to mirror the important parts of hosting, caching, plugins, themes, and content so your tests reflect real conditions as much as possible.
